Want to go back to work as a Licensed Practical Nurse? The time has never been better. With Bow Valley College, you can study part-time to update your knowledge and skills to meet the current practice standards and licensure requirements for Practical Nurses in Alberta. This four-stage program includes a challenge exam, online study, workshops, and a seven-week preceptored clinical.

Admission requirements
Academic Requirements
• Graduate of a recognized Practical Nurse Program
• Referral from the College of Licensed Practical Nurses of Alberta (CLPNA)
• Credit in a Medical Terminology course
Pre-Program Requirements
The criteria listed below must be completed prior to the first day of classes:
• Current valid immunization report required and must be approved by BVC Health Services
• Current Police Information Check (PIC)
• Current CPR Health Care Provider Level Certificate
Note: Students who have not submitted their documents by the start of the program will have their Letter of Admission withdrawn.
Additional Admission Requirements
It is strongly advised that applicants have computer access with word processing and Internet capabilities.
Note: Every effort is made to accommodate students in clinical placements within the time frame of the program. In some cases, students may be required to complete their clinical placements during evening and weekend hours or by travelling to alternative locations. In rare instances, the College may need to delay the date of completion until a clinical placement can be arranged.
